Qualifications and Program Choices

The Complete Guide to Medical Assistant Classes

Although there are not very many requirements in training to be a Certified Medical Assistant, you should pay attention to the few that do exist. You must meet the minimum age limit, along with having a high school diploma or equivalent, test negative for Tuberculosis and Hepatitis and pass a background check.

Certification and Licensing

Is it a Requirement That I Get a Certification?

Regarding all future (MA) Medical Assistants, the AAMA – American Association of Medical Assistants has stressed and demanded that MA – Medical Assistant certification is held before holding a job. When you have been given your certification, make sure you get on the registry managed by the American Registry of Medical Assistants, that provides a registry for credentialed Certified Medical Assistant should be on. After getting listed and certified, you can anticipate increased pay and a greater probability of employment.

You might want to keep in mind not every states have similar requirements for accreditation or job eligibility. Make certain you determine what is needed with your school and your state board.
